组合逻辑电路分析:二进制译码器在码制变换中的应用
需积分: 42 89 浏览量
更新于2024-07-12
收藏 2.5MB PPT 举报
"该资源是关于数字模拟电路的PPT,特别关注了如何使用二进制译码器实现码制变换,例如将十进制码转换为8421码。内容涵盖了组合逻辑电路的基本概念、分析方法和设计,包括组合逻辑电路的特点、功能描述方法以及具体的逻辑电路分析示例。"
在数字电路中,组合逻辑电路是一种关键的电路类型,其特点是输出仅取决于当前输入的状态,不依赖于电路的前一状态,也就是说,它没有记忆功能。这种电路通常由各种逻辑门如AND、OR、NOT等构成,没有反馈环路,确保了信号处理的即时性。
组合逻辑电路的分析方法主要包括以下几个步骤:
1. 了解电路功能:首先需要理解电路的预期目标,即它要实现什么样的逻辑功能。
2. 写出逻辑表达式:根据电路图,我们可以用布尔代数的规则来表示输出与输入之间的关系,得到输出的逻辑函数表达式。
3. 表达式化简:对得到的逻辑表达式进行简化,可以使用德摩根定律、代数法或卡诺图等方法,目的是为了得到最简形式,便于理解和实现。
4. 列出真值表:基于逻辑表达式,我们可以列出所有可能输入组合对应的输出结果,形成真值表。
5. 分析逻辑功能:根据真值表或简化后的表达式,我们可以明确地描述电路的具体功能。
以例1为例,电路的逻辑功能是,当输入A、B、C中有两个或三个为1时,输出Y为1,否则为0,这就是一个简单的三人表决器。而例2中的电路是一个奇偶校验器,如果输入A、B、C中有奇数个1,则输出Y为1,表示存在奇数个1,反之,如果有偶数个1,则输出Y为0。
此外,二进制译码器是组合逻辑电路的一种,常用于码制变换。例如,8421码是一种二进制权重编码,其中每个位的权重分别是8、4、2、1,因此,一个四位的8421码可以表示10进制的0到15。通过二进制译码器,我们可以将这种编码与其他码制(如格雷码或二进制反码)进行转换。
这个PPT深入探讨了组合逻辑电路的原理和应用,包括二进制译码器在码制变换中的作用,对于理解和设计数字电路具有重要的指导价值。
2020-12-21 上传
2013-11-15 上传
2023-10-28 上传
2021-03-20 上传
2009-07-10 上传
2022-11-18 上传
2021-10-08 上传
2014-07-02 上传
2008-11-16 上传
速本
- 粉丝: 20
- 资源: 2万+
最新资源
- 探索AVL树算法:以Faculdade Senac Porto Alegre实践为例
- 小学语文教学新工具:创新黑板设计解析
- Minecraft服务器管理新插件ServerForms发布
- MATLAB基因网络模型代码实现及开源分享
- 全方位技术项目源码合集:***报名系统
- Phalcon框架实战案例分析
- MATLAB与Python结合实现短期电力负荷预测的DAT300项目解析
- 市场营销教学专用查询装置设计方案
- 随身WiFi高通210 MS8909设备的Root引导文件破解攻略
- 实现服务器端级联:modella与leveldb适配器的应用
- Oracle Linux安装必备依赖包清单与步骤
- Shyer项目:寻找喜欢的聊天伙伴
- MEAN堆栈入门项目: postings-app
- 在线WPS办公功能全接触及应用示例
- 新型带储订盒订书机设计文档
- VB多媒体教学演示系统源代码及技术项目资源大全